当前位置: 首页 > 知识库问答 >
问题:

Java程序在IDE上运行,但不在终端上运行[重复]

韩彦君
2023-03-14

我有一个简单的Java代码:

package com.company;
import java.util.Scanner;

public class Main {
    public static void main(String[] args) {
        System.out.println("Please enter number of the days");
        Scanner scanner = new Scanner(System.in);
        int days = scanner.nextInt();

        System.out.println("The number of seconds in the entered days number is "+days*86400);
    }
}

文件夹结构为:src\com\company

在文件夹company中,有main.javamain.class文件。

    null
java Main.class
    null
java com.company.Main.class
java.com.company.Main

这里怎么了?

共有1个答案

顾磊
2023-03-14

修改Java文件以生成类:

javac文件名

执行生成的类:

 类似资料:
  • 每当我运行命令python3.6 Check.py时,我都会得到以下错误:, 熊猫误差 回溯(最后一次调用):文件“/usr/lib/python3/dist-packages/pandas/_-libs/init.py”,第30行,从pandas开始。_-libs导入哈希表为_-hashtable,lib为_-lib,tslib为_-tslib文件“/usr/lib/python3/dist-p

  • 问题内容: 我正在运行一个Perl脚本,该脚本用另一个字符串替换: 当我从终端运行此命令时,它会将给定文件中所有出现的替换为。当我从Java运行此文件时,它确实访问了文件,但没有替换发生: 我确定它可以访问文件(该文件似乎已在gedit中进行了编辑(需要重新加载))。 我尝试了Java 类,但发生了相同的结果。 当我使用或与其他命令(例如)一起使用时,它们可以很好地工作。 具有讽刺意味的是,我从j

  • 问题内容: 我在CI和CD上创建了Jenkinsfile,Dockerfile,Dockerfile.test到CI和CD,在GitHub上构建了我的服务器API,我在Jenkins上构建了该构建,并且构建成功,并且我的docker在Jenkinsfile阶段也在容器上运行,我创建了用于测试和部署在服务器API上,并使用docker作为容器 我也使用docker-compose在docker上运行

  • 我创建了一个JasperReport应用程序,它在tomcat服务器上运行良好。但是当我使用相同的jar在Jboss上运行时,它会显示错误 原因:java.lang.ClassCastException:org.apache.xerces.jaxp.DocumentBuilderFactoryImpl无法强制转换为javax.xml.parsers.DocumentBuilderFactor.ne

  • 问题内容: 我尝试了以下文档以在Google云上运行node.js应用程序:https : //cloud.google.com/nodejs/getting-started/hello- world Node.js运行正常,但是如果我运行,我会…。 问题答案: 最新的Google Cloud SDK 0.9.65版本存在一个错误。 您可以使用以下命令还原到Cloud SDK 0.9.64: 下一